A short overview of "SYZEFXIS", the National Network of Public Administration in Greece and the IPv6 deployment issues, preneted at the “IPv6 for innovative government and public services” Workshop, Athens, Greece, April 21, 2015.

  16. 16. 16 IPv6 Deployment Dr. Haris Stellakis – 04/2015  IPv6 support on both access and distribution networks  IPv6 support on all Data Center equipment  Every new network element installed is IPv6 ready  On already existing infrastructure, IPv6 will be supported through technologies that will be selected on a per case basis (ex. via tunneling) • Major selection criteria include operation ability, security and manageability  Transition will be based on best practices (ex. NAT64, XLATDSLite, etc)  Detailed transition plan will be determined during Project Design Phase, taking into account the entire project and vendor info at that time
  17. 17. 17 IPv6 Roadmap  Complete network status assessment • Investigation includes both equipment and services offered  Design phase I – external networks (ex. Internet, S-Testa, etc.)  Design phase II – SYZEFXIS subprojects  Design phase III – Public Agencies internal infrastructure  Security policy update  Personnel training  Pilot transition  Assessment of pilot transition  Transition (gradual) of entire network • External networks • Backbone • Distribution & Access • Data Centers SIX • Internal infrastructures  Parallel support of IPv4/IPv6 Dr. Haris Stellakis – 04/2015
  18. 18. 18 IPv6 Deployment Challenges Dr. Haris Stellakis – 04/2015 Different Vendors (even for one subproject due to Contract Framework tender process) Existing Infrastructure / Services (of Public Agencies) 5 Subprojects  SYZEFXIS II is a multi-subproject effort  Subprojects #1, 2 & 4 are implemented through a contract framework tender process, that leads to various vendors (and platforms) per subproject  Public Agencies internal infrastructure: Technical & Operational obstacles that cause delays  Transition should be performed on an already alive network, serving the core of Public Sector (SYZEFXIS I)  System data and specs will be finalized upon all contract signing
  19. 19. 19 Epilogue  SYZEFXIS I runs on IPv4 technology  IPv6 is (by design) available on SYZEFXIS II  Information Society S.A., in collaboration with major project stakeholders: • Ministry of Public Reform, • The EU Managing Authorities, and • The project vendors • The Public Agencies have been and will be taking all necessary actions (through RFP requirements and formal project management processes) towards a successful IPv6 deployment in SYZEFXIS network.
